Option Function
Custom Test Tests a specific device. You can customize the tests you want
to run.
Symptom Tree Lists the most common symptoms encountered and allows
you to select a test based on the symptom of the problem you
are having.
2
If a problem is encountered during a test, a message appears with an error
code and a description of the problem. Write down the error code and
problem description, and follow the instructions on the screen.
If you cannot resolve the error condition, contact Dell (see "Contacting
Dell" in your
User’s Guide
).
NOTE: The Service Tag for your computer is located at the top of each test
screen. If you contact Dell, the technical support representative will ask you
for your Service Tag.
3
If you run a test from the
Custom Test
or
Symptom Tree
option, click the
applicable tab described in the following table for more information.
Tab Function
Results Displays the results of the test and any error conditions
encountered.
Errors Displays error conditions encountered, error codes, and the
problem description.
Help Describes the test and may indicate requirements for running
the test.
Configuration Displays your hardware configuration for the selected device.
The Dell Diagnostics obtains configuration information for
all devices from the system setup program, memory, and
various internal tests, and it displays the information in the
device list in the left pane of the screen. The device list may
not display the names of all the components installed on your
computer or all devices attached to your computer.
Parameters Allows you to customize the test by changing the test
settings.
